If you want improved indoor air top quality, then you have to have a high quality air purifier. Air purifiers lower the airborne allergens that aggravate allergies and asthma. As dirty, contaminated air flows via the air purifier, fresh, clean air flows into your residence. The variety of air filter in an air purifier determines how the air purifier works – and how effectively it operates.

HEPA Filters

HEPA air filters set the typical for air cleaners now. In the 1940s, the U.S. Atomic Energy Commission developed HEPA (Higher Energy Particulate Air) filters in an try to filter radioactive contaminants. To be classified as a HEPA filter, it should capture a minimum of 99.97% of pollutants at .3 microns.

HEPA filtration captures particles 25-50 occasions smaller sized than the eye can see. The ultra-fine fibers in HEPA filters capture microscopic particles through a mixture of diffusion, interception, and inertial impaction. With smaller particles, diffusion happens when the random motion of the particles causes them to collide with fibers. Interception happens when larger particles directly collide with a fiber. When a particle’s inertia leads to its collision with a fiber, this is recognized as inertial impaction.

HEGA Filters

You may have also heard of HEGA or High Efficiency Gas Adsorber filters. Precise to Austin Air, HEGA filters should exhibit a minimum efficiency of 99.9%, per requirements of the Institute of Environmental Sciences, and use “adsorber” filtration to filter out chemical compounds, gases, and odors.

Adsorber filtration combines carbon or carbon/zeolite pellets into a carbon cloth filter to trap gaseous particles. Specific to the HEGA filter, the adsorber filtration method must be made, constructed, filled and packaged to adhere to these particular requirements. The HEGA air filter need to also get rid of irritants like dust, pollen, mold spores, bacteria, and pet dander to be viewed as a HEGA filter.

Activated Carbon Filters

Activated carbon filters get rid of gases, odors, and chemical toxins. Carbon, or activated charcoal, is treated with oxygen to open up the millions of tiny pores among the carbon atoms.

The activated charcoal adsorbs odorous substances from gases or liquids. The term “adsorbing” refers to the way the pollutants attach to the charcoal by chemical attraction. The significant surface area of the activated charcoal provides it thousands of pores for trapping pollutants. As chemical compounds and pollutants pass the carbon surface, they are immediately attracted and captured within the filter.

Some carbon filters are treated with added chemicals like potassium iodide or potassium permanganate which increase the carbon filter’s ability to capture Volatile Organic Compounds (VOCs) and other chemically reactive gases. Activated carbon filters adsorb a wider spectrum of contaminants.

Electrostatic Filters

Like Activated Carbon filters, Electrostatic filters attract pollutants. Rather of carbon, Electrostatic filters use electrostatic charges to clean the air. Electrostatic charges are produced by pushing air by means of a maze of static prone fibers. As airborne particles move past the static prone fibers, they develop into attracted to the static charge and are captured inside the filter. The particles stay on collector plates till they are hand washed or removed by a HEPA vacuum cleaner.

By applying static electrical energy, you in no way have to be concerned about replacing the filters, as most electrostatic air cleaners use collection plates to capture pollutants and can be cleaned quickly. Having said that, the collection plates need to be cleaned regularly to make sure helpful air cleaning. Also, unlike HEPA filters, some electrostatic filters emit ozone, a hazardous lung irritant that can trigger asthma and allergy symptoms, as properly as other respiratory troubles.

Charged Media Filters

Charged media filters also utilize electrostatic power. Produced from synthetic fibers, the media filter is charged through the manufacturing process and retains the charge for the duration of its use. This charge attracts airborne particles, giving them an electrostatic charge prior to trapping them inside the fibers of a conventional filter.

Charged media filters present relatively low energy charges and are very effective. Even so, as the filter becomes soiled, it becomes resistant to the airflow, producing it significantly less effective the a lot more soiled it becomes. Therefore, charged media filters need to be changed consistently for peak performance.

Hybrid Air Filtration Systems

The Hybrid air filtration method maximizes its effectiveness by way of the use of several technologies. Hybrid air purifiers use a mixture of filtration solutions, each and every filter adding to the general successful excellent of the air purifier. Most successful air purifiers a use combinations of the filters listed above.
